Review Title:   No Tenant Loyalty- They Take As Much As They Can
Reviewer:   Anonymous
Review Date:   6/2/2005

I wanted to reply to this previous post. I have to concur with most of the list items mentioned here, except for the fact that the appliances are 30 years old. My roomates and I are renting a renovated apartment, with newer appliances. Unfortunately they have raised the rent on everyone pretty significantly. Even those tenants who have lived here 20 years, many elderly people who were forced to move out, because they jacked up the rent so much. Its true that the management does spend an exhorbinant amount of time making sure the lobby sparkles, I see the same man polishing those floors nearly everyday. But if you take a closer look, look at the age of the windows in this place. Plus there is at least 3 computers broken at any given time, and they usually stay broken for 30 days or longer. Moreover, they now charge newcommers utilities, because the management feels they can. I can only assume people will pay this for the close proximity to DC. All in all I like living here, but I doubt my roomates and I will be able to continue to live here once our lease expires. Our last renewal increase was about $625.00, and there is no doubt in any of our minds that they will jack up our rent at least 30%. Tenant loyalty means nothing to Charles Smith.
